Output ded61dcfca98e04f6b2c89f2585d4f2ea0c5cc99a18b7bef453a2454cb57bab3:0

value
169775966024
script pubkey
OP_0 OP_PUSHBYTES_20 254903f1c8539f86ca203222ab089427ec4892ec
address
tb1qy4ys8uwg2w0cdj3qxg32kzy5ylky3yhvmrewmu
transaction
ded61dcfca98e04f6b2c89f2585d4f2ea0c5cc99a18b7bef453a2454cb57bab3
spent
true